Function and Role of the Drain Hose in Whirlpool Washing Systems

The 285664 Whirlpool Drain Hose serves​ as the primary⁤ conduit for evacuating wastewater from⁢ the washer tub and pump‍ assembly to the household drain or standpipe. In normal operation the hose must ⁣tolerate pulsed flow created by⁢ the drain pump, maintain its internal ‌diameter under suction and pressure swingsand resist ⁤kinking⁣ or collapse that would restrict flow. material ⁣selection and end fittings on the 285664 Whirlpool Drain Hose ‌are designed to match Whirlpool pump outlets and common clamp styles; a poor fit at the connection can cause leaks, air ingressor reduced pump efficiency,⁤ which technicians can detect by observing extended pump ‍run times or⁢ intermittent ​drainage during ‌cycle tests.

  • Construction: flexible, abrasion- and chemical-resistant material with reinforced ends for secure⁣ clamping.
  • Connection compatibility: engineered to mate ‍with common Whirlpool pump outlets or adapter fittings to avoid misalignment.
  • Behavior under load: resists collapse⁣ during suction, tolerates pulsed flow⁤ without trapping air pockets.
  • Failure⁤ symptoms: slow draining, visible leaks at joints, odors from‌ trapped wateror collapsed sections.

For compatibility and practical replacement, confirm the part number and physically verify‍ inner diameter, hose lengthand connector style against the washer’s pump ‌outlet before installation;‍ matching these parameters prevents stress‍ on the pump⁤ and‍ ensures correct drainage velocity. Route​ the hose with ⁢a secure high loop‌ or to the specified standpipe height to minimize siphoning and backflow,‌ and inspect clamps⁢ and hose ends for corrosion or deformation during service-replace the hose if cracks, brittlenessor permanent kinks are ⁢present to restore​ reliable drainage and prevent intermittent faults.

How the 285664 Whirlpool⁣ Drain Hose Operates Within the Appliance Drain and Pump assembly

The 285664 Whirlpool Drain Hose functions ​as the flexible conduit between the appliance sump/pump assembly⁤ and the household drain⁣ or air gap, carrying discharged​ water away during ‍pump cycles. When the⁤ drain pump (centrifugal ⁤type) runs, the hose ⁤must accept the pump’s flow and transient pressure pulses without collapsing,‌ leakingor creating⁣ backpressure that would impair pump performance. Proper mechanical mating is via the hose’s molded bead to the​ pump outlet or a spigot on the drain assembly and is secured with a clamp; ​matching inner diameter, material compatibility (typically reinforced elastomer or PVC)and correct orientation are required to ⁣preserve sealing surfaces‍ and avoid stress⁣ at ​the connection point. Technicians ‍replacing ‌or⁢ routing the 285664 Whirlpool drain Hose should confirm the hose ​seating depth, ⁢clamp torqueand that​ the hose path maintains a⁣ gradual slope ⁣and avoids kinks or ⁣sharp bends ⁢that reduce flow or ‍trap debris.

Within the drain and pump assembly the hose also affects noise, priming behaviorand susceptibility to clogs: air pockets, tight bendsor partial occlusions can cause cavitation or audible vibration during the pump’s high-flow discharge phase. The hose interface may be adjacent to a ⁤check ⁣valve,air⁣ gap,or trap; misalignment or wrong length⁤ can ‍allow siphoning,permit trap water to re-enter ⁢the chamber,or create leak points at the joint. Routine inspection should target cracks,soft spots,collapsed corrugations,and⁢ secure clamps; cleaning the inlet strainer ​and verifying unobstructed flow through the⁢ hose during a manual drain ‌test are practical ‍diagnostics to verify proper integration with the ​pump and drain⁣ assembly.

  • Key checks: correct connection to pump⁤ outlet, unclamped sections removed, ⁤smooth routingand intact hose wall.
  • Common symptoms of failure: intermittent drainage, gurgling sounds, visible leaks at the ​hose jointor pump overheating from restricted flow.

Common Failure Symptoms and Diagnostic Procedures for Drain Hose Leaks, ‌Clogsand kinks

The 285664 Whirlpool drain Hose is a flexible conduit that conveys⁢ wastewater from the washer⁣ pump to the household drain or standpipe; its primary functions are‌ to ⁢maintain a sealed fluid path ⁢under⁤ transient pressure and to resist abrasion and kinking while under repetitive flexing. ​Typical failure⁤ modes⁢ include axial splits at the hose-to-pump or hose-to-standpipe junctions, abrasion wear where the hose rubs⁣ against chassis componentsand⁣ material deformation that permits permanent kinks. These failures alter flow characteristics (reduced peak flow, increased backpressure) and can allow leaks under dynamic load-examples include slow draining during the rinse cycle caused by an internal collapse or intermittent ‌leakage from a failing ⁤crimp clamp during heavy spin cycles.

  • Slow drain or standing water in the tub
  • Visible wetness or drips near hose connections
  • Gurgling, sputteringor pump overload/noise during drain
  • Intermittent error codes related to water level or drain‍ faults

Diagnostic procedure sequence: ⁢perform a visual and tactile⁤ inspection for cuts, soft spotsor crushed⁣ sections; run a controlled drain cycle while observing ‌hose routing and connection points for movement or seepage; if flow‍ is reduced, disconnect the hose downstream (catching water) and verify unobstructed flow and pump output to separate pump failure from hose clogging. Use a low-pressure air or water flush from ‍the pump end to dislodge ⁣debrisand deploy a borescope ‌for internal inspection⁣ if available. For compatibility checks, verify that the hose coupling geometry and clamp type of the 285664 ⁤Whirlpool Drain Hose match the washer’s pump outlet and standpipe interface⁣ before ⁣replacing to avoid mismatch ⁢that can cause leaks or premature failure.

Compatibility,⁣ Replacement ‍Considerationsand Installation Procedures for the 285664 Drain ⁢Hose

The 285664 Whirlpool Drain Hose is a flexible wastewater conveyance component designed to carry discharge from the appliance pump to the household drain or standpipe.Its function is controlled by ‍inner diameter,⁢ wall‌ construction, end fittings and overall length: these determine flow rate, pressure toleranceand the ability to route without kinking. Compatibility ⁣is governed ​by ⁣the hose’s connector ‌type (clamp-on barb, crimped Ferruleor rapid-connect), the⁤ sealing face geometry ⁣on‌ the appliance tailpieceand whether the hose ​meets local anti-siphon or air-gap requirements. Materials‌ commonly used ⁤(EPDM, thermoplastic elastomeror corrugated PVC) affect chemical resistance to detergents and temperature stability; select a hose whose construction matches the appliance environment and pump discharge characteristics​ rather then relying on length alone.

Replacement and⁢ installation require ⁤a parts-match check and a controlled procedure: first verify that​ the 285664 designation or its equivalent matches the appliance​ tailpiece ‌geometry and‌ the⁢ required routing length. Inspect the old ​hose and connection for brittle cracks, collapsed ⁣corrugationsor corroded tailpieces; replace ‌a damaged⁢ tailpiece or use the correct adapter rather than forcing a mismatched​ hose.During installation, ensure the‍ hose has a⁢ constant downward slope where ​possible, avoid tight bends within the first few inches of the pump outletand secure connections‍ with appropriately sized ‍stainless-steel clamps to prevent seepage. Typical field steps include the‍ checklist below and a short filling/drain test under normal load to verify there are no leaks and ‍that the ⁤hose does not siphon or trap water.

  • Shut off power and water supply and move‍ the appliance to access the rear connections.
  • Loosen and remove the​ existing clamp, then ‌detach the hose from the tailpiece and pump outlet.
  • Inspect and⁢ clean mating surfaces; replace corroded tailpieces or ‌damaged ferrules before fitting the new hose.
  • Slide ‍the new⁤ hose onto the tailpiece and⁢ pump ⁢outlet, position a stainless-steel clamp over the joint, ⁣and tighten untill the clamp compresses the sealing surface without deforming it.
  • Route the hose to avoid ‌kinks,maintain required ‍standpipe height or​ air gap,and secure ⁣with straps as needed.
  • Restore water and‌ power, run a drain cycleand inspect all joints for leaks; ‍re-tighten clamps only if minor seepage is present-avoid over-tightening ⁣that can cut the hose.

What is the Whirlpool 285664 drain hose?

the 285664 drain hose is ​a replacement wastewater discharge hose sold for Whirlpool-brand laundry appliances.It carries used wash water‌ from the washer’s pump/tub to a standpipe, laundry sink, ⁤or household drain. It⁣ is a flexible, appliance-grade ​drain hose designed to replace ⁢a worn or damaged original hose.

How do I⁢ confirm 285664 will fit my specific Whirlpool washer?

Confirm compatibility by checking your washer’s model‍ number (usually ⁣on a tag inside the door opening, on the backor‍ on the ⁣cabinet).⁣ Enter the appliance model number on the Whirlpool parts site or a reputable parts supplier and search for part 285664 ‌in the parts ‍diagram. If you cannot find it, contact the supplier or Whirlpool support with your model number to verify fitment before purchase.

What material and connector type is the 285664 hose made of?

Most replacement drain hoses like the 285664 are made of flexible, corrugated plastic​ or⁤ reinforced rubber designed for wastewater use. They typically use a slip-on connection that secures to the washer pump outlet or tub with a worm-gear (screw) clamp or spring clamp.Exact materials and connector details should be⁣ verified on the product ​listing or parts blowup⁤ for your model.

How do I install the 285664 drain hose safely​ and correctly?

Basic installation steps: 1) Unplug the washer and turn ⁢off water (if applicable). 2) Access the old hose (rear panel or lift the washer as needed).3) Loosen the clamp, pull ‍the old ‍hose off the pump/tub and drainpoint; remove it. ⁢4) ‍Push‍ the new 285664 ⁤hose onto the pump outlet or ⁤tub ‌spud fully, then secure it with a⁤ properly ‌sized worm-gear or spring clamp. 5) Route the hose to ⁤the standpipe/sink without kinks or ⁤sharp bendsand secure‍ the hose to the​ standpipe or faucet bracket ‍per⁢ the washer manual. 6)⁣ Restore power‌ and run a short cycle to check for leaks.⁢ Use gloves and follow lockout/energy ‌isolation practices when working near electrical components.

Can I trim or extend the 285664 hoseand how high should the drain hose be positioned?

You can usually trim ‍excess flexible hose length if ‍you have a clean cut at a smooth section-not at molded fittings-and then re-clamp securely. Extending a​ hose is possible ⁣with an approved connector or extension hose; avoid ad-hoc couplings⁣ that can leak ‍or clog. Follow your washer’s installation instructions⁤ for recommended standpipe height; many washers require the drain hose inlet to be ‌at a specific height above the floor (check your manual). Improper height can ‍cause ⁢siphoning or strain the pump.

What are the common problems⁣ with the 285664 drain ⁤hose and how do I troubleshoot them?

Common issues: kinks⁢ restricting flow, internal clogs (lint/soap buildup), ⁤split/cracked⁤ hose causing ⁢leaksand loose clamps leaking at⁤ connections. ⁢Troubleshooting: inspect for visible damage ​or kinks, run water through the hose to‌ check flow, remove and⁢ clear ⁤blockages ​(use a drain snake or ‍high-flow water⁤ flush)and replace the hose if brittle, ⁣swollen, ‌or cracked. Ensure clamps are tight⁢ and the hose is routed​ without sharp bends.

Is 285664 ⁢an original OEM part and should I choose OEM over aftermarket?

Part numbers like 285664 are typically OEM designations used‍ by Whirlpool​ and authorized parts​ suppliers. Using an OEM hose ensures shape,⁤ length, fittingsand materials match ⁤the original. Many aftermarket hoses will work and may be less expensive, but verify dimensions, connector type,‍ and ​warranty. For ⁤guaranteed fit and to preserve appliance warranty⁢ terms,⁤ OEM is usually recommended.
